WebBaby rabbits cannot drink cow milk because it is hard to digest for them and can lead to health issues and even death. There have been quite a few cases of baby rabbits dying after consuming cow milk. So, it’s best not to feed your little friend cow milk. Instead, you can give them goat milk or kitten milk replacer (KMR).
WebHumans can drink rabbit milk; however, it doesn’t contain much nutritional value (way less value than cow’s milk). A rabbit’s milk has a creamy white appearance similar to cow’s milk, but a bunny’s milk has a salty taste. It isn’t easy to milk a rabbit, and a bunny only produces enough milk for its kits.
